Drinks & Nightlife

Laid-back Noir will leave you full and satisfied for less than €7 with its long list of cocktails, wines, beers and even Guinness. To accompany the beverages is an extensive list of jaw-busting panini and piadine (from €4). Herbivores aren't overlooked, with flesh-free combos like aubergine, zucchini, rucola, salad and cheese. No wonder it's a solid favourite with the university crowd.
15 locals recommend
Cafe Noir
3805 Dorsoduro

Sightseeing

Although it is easy to get the impression that almost everything in Venice seems to have an admission fee, it comes as a surprise that the Serenissima's most famous attraction, the Basilica di San Marco, does not charge visitors. Dominating the Piazza San Marco with its fairytale facade – though be prepared for at least part to be covered for renovation – the basilica is the ultimate symbol of Venice's former glory, and the domed interiors are marked by breathtaking intricate mosaics. Be aware, though, that once inside, there are fees if you want a tour of St Mark's Museum, the Treasury or the lustrous Pala d'Oro!
211 locals recommend
Tesoro della Basilica di San Marco
328 P.za San Marco

Getting Around

The only connection between the Venice mainland and the lagoon. Here you find parkiking for your car, take public bus and also boats!
123 locals recommend
Piazzale Roma

Here there is the water bus stop for line 1 and 2, and there is also the "gondola traghetto" , reach the other side of the canal by riding a gondola, for only 2€ each person.
8 locals recommend
San Tomà
